The Complexity of CIRS Charting in Cerbo EHR
CIRS charting in Cerbo EHR is uniquely demanding because biotoxin illness is a multi-system, multi-symptom condition that does not fit into standard medical documentation templates. Clinicians must evaluate and track symptoms across 13 distinct symptom clusters, which include everything from cognitive executive dysfunction and word-finding difficulties to physical joint pain, light sensitivity, and temperature dysregulation. Documenting these findings during a standard patient visit can overwhelm a clinician, leading to compromised patient engagement or hours of after-hours data entry.
In addition to symptom tracking, a comprehensive CIRS chart must detail environmental exposure histories, including previous water-damaged buildings, and record environmental testing metrics. Providers routinely track scores from the Environmental Relative Moldiness Index (ERMI) or the HERTSMI-2 rating system. In a standard EHR interface, entering these numbers, tracking Visual Contrast Sensitivity (VCS) test results, and maintaining a history of sequential lab markers like TGF-beta1, C4a, MSH, and MMP-9 requires constant clicking and navigation.
While Cerbo EHR offers flexible templating tools like "Chart Parts" to paste pre-configured text, clinicians must still manually select, customize, and fill in these templates for each patient. For a comprehensive new-patient consult that often runs 60 to 90 mins, compiling these complex clinical narratives manually can easily add 30 to 45 mins of charting time per encounter.

Pushing Structured CIRS SOAP Notes Directly to Cerbo EHR
Pushing structured CIRS SOAP notes directly to Cerbo EHR is possible because of Meelio's robust, bi-directional API integration. Once you have reviewed and approved your AI-drafted SOAP note within the Meelio Desktop App, you can send it directly to Cerbo with a single click. This eliminates the need to manually copy and paste text between different windows, a common source of workflow friction in busy clinics.
Within the Meelio interface, clicking the "Sync to Cerbo" button opens a dialog where you can choose to create a new encounter note or append the draft to an existing, unsigned encounter in Cerbo. This flexibility is essential for CIRS care, where follow-up visits build on previous diagnostic workups. You can specify the date of service, select the encounter type (such as Office Visit or Follow-up), and map the note to the correct practitioner. Attaching CIRS Care Plans and Lab Summaries to the Patient Chart
Attaching CIRS care plans and lab summaries to the patient's chart maintains clinical organization. In addition to encounter notes, CIRS treatment involves separate documents like binder instructions, dietary guidelines, and lab summaries. Meelio renders these AI-generated care plans into clean, professional PDF files and uploads them directly to Cerbo EHR.
When attaching PDFs, checking a box routes the file directly to the practitioner's Cerbo review queue for sign-off. Leaving it unchecked files the PDF directly into the patient's chart history. To keep charts organized, Meelio automatically generates clean chart document names (such as "CIRS Care Plan" or "Biotoxin Protocol") that omit redundant dates or patient names, safely keeping them under Cerbo's 255-character limit.
